IPA: //ʌn.kəmˈpleɪ.nɪŋ//
KK: /ʌnˈkəmˌpleɪnɪŋ/
This word describes someone who does not express dissatisfaction or annoyance, even in difficult situations. They remain patient and tolerant without voicing complaints.
Despite the long hours and hard work, she remained uncomplaining and focused on her tasks.
